Investing the Impact of Expansion of the Rural-Urban Public Transport System on the Economic and Social Development in Rural Areas in the Eastern Region of Bandpey in Babol County

Abstract:

Purpose: In rural areas of developing countries, lack of facilities and geographical isolation can be considered as the major causes of poverty leading to limited opportunities in achieving sustainable economic and social improvement. Public transport system has a crucial role in the prevention of social and economic exclusion and marginalization of rural and remote areas. Access to public transport can have various effects on economic and social development of these areas. In this article we studied the role of the communication network and public transport system in economic and social development of the rural areas. Therefore it is intended to answer the following questions: - What are the different views of mountain village people and plain village people about rural road network and rural – urban public transport system? - Do the factors like improvement of network construction and expansion of rural roads and public transport systems lead to economic boom in the study area? - Do the factors like network construction, improvement of rural roads and expansion of public transport systems lead to improvement of social conditions in the study area? Methodology: The research was done on the base of descriptive and exploratory method. The population of this research is the forest-mountain and plain villagers chosen in the eastern region of Bandpey in Babol County. Due to the purpose of the research,  descriptive-analytical method was chosen. The data were collected by questionnaires. Validity of the questionnaires were confirmed by applying Cronbach formula with 78%. Residents of plain-forest and mountain-forest villages from Sajadroad and Fyrozjah rural districts are study population. The relative sampling method was used in the present study and for analysing the data, descriptive methods by SPSS software were applied. Finding: It is shown that there are significant differences between the forest-mountain and plain villages in all fields of services like safety, infrastructure, quality of the communication network, and transport system and these factors influence the economic and social development except the quality of the asphalt. In the villages of the plains, two factors of safety road network and public transport system have influential role in the economic and social development. In the forest-foothill villages, social development is influenced by quality improvement of the infrastructure elements and economic development is affected by expanding safety road network and public transport system. Research Limitation:  Limited numbers of forest-mountain villages are selected as sample. Practical Implications: In all societies, rural transport system has been considered as a prerequisite for progress and one of the important aspects of rural development. Furthermore, expanding road network and public transport are regarded as prerequisites and foundations of development in communities which have potential productivity. The aforesaid factors provide unbreakable bond between remote areas like rural ones with socio-economic development and ultimately prevent isolationism in closed economy of rural areas by strengthen the sense of belonging to a larger community. Original/Value: Transportation is a prerequisite for the development of rural areas.
